Alla Luna Footbridge
Ponte alla Luna
Sasso di Castalda, Potenza, Italy
335 feet high / 102 meters high
(984) foot span / (300) meter span
2017


Italy's largest public footbridge span, the Alla Luna Footbridge opened in 2017 as the most spectacular tourist attraction within the small mountain town of Sasso di Castalda. The "Bridge of the Moon" theme celebrates Italian rocket engineer Rocco Petrone who worked on the famous Saturn 5 rocket that sent many American astronauts to the moon.
